Like medical insurance, oral insurance works by sharing the prices of oral treatment for a costs you pay. You may also have to pay deductibles, copays and other prices, however the details differ from strategy to plan. Here are some common regards to dental insurance coverage plans: A costs is what you pay your insurer for protection.


A common costs may be $20$50/month for a private or $50$150/month for a family members based upon the kind of protection (https://experiment.com/users/mepps). 1 An insurance deductible is the amount you pay toward particular dental costs before your insurance coverage starts. : if you have a $1,000 deductible, you pay the initial $1,000 of protected solutions and then a fixed amount (ex.


: if your oral plan pays 70% of the cost, your coinsurance repayment is the continuing to be 30% of the expense. A yearly optimum is the restriction your oral insurance policy will certainly pay toward the expense of dental therapy in a plan year.

Oral amalgam has a huge amount of mercury. If you have a high quantity of mercury in your body, you can pass it to your baby via the placenta or when nursing.


Mercury likewise can trigger damages to the mind, kidneys and other body organs. You ought to not obtain dental amalgam dental fillings if you are pregnant, planning to get expectant or nursing, according to the united state Fda (FDA). If you require to have actually a dental caries filled up, ask your dental expert for a mercury-free composite resin dental filling.


It is made from a kind of plastic blended with powdered glass. Composite resin dental fillings do not consist of poisonous steels such as mercury and are risk-free for you and your child. The FDA does not suggest that you eliminate any type of dental amalgam filling up that you already have unless your dentist states that there is an issue with the dental filling.
